-- create the x axis - wait events (independent value)
-- drop table r2_x_value purge;
set echo off verify off
COLUMN dbid NEW_VALUE _dbid NOPRINT
select dbid from v$database;
COLUMN instancenumber NEW_VALUE _instancenumber NOPRINT
select instance_number instancenumber from v$instance;
create table r2_x_value as
select
snap_id,
tm,
inst,
dur,
event stat_name,
waits diff
from
(select snap_id, tm, inst, dur, event, waits, time, avgwt, pctdbt, aas, wait_class,
DENSE_RANK() OVER (
PARTITION BY snap_id ORDER BY time DESC) event_rank
from
(
select * from
(select * from (select
s0.snap_id snap_id,
s0.END_INTERVAL_TIME tm,
s0.instance_number inst,
round(EXTRACT(DAY F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 1440
+ EXTRACT(HOUR F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 60
+ EXTRACT(MINUTE F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ME)
+ EXTRACT(SECOND F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) / 60, 2) dur,
e.event_name event,
e.total_waits - nvl(b.total_waits,0) waits,
round ((e.time_waited_micro - nvl(b.time_waited_micro,0))/1000000, 2) time, -- THIS IS EVENT (sec)
round (decode ((e.total_waits - nvl(b.total_waits, 0)), 0, to_number(NULL), ((e.time_waited_micro - nvl(b.time_waited_micro,0))/1000) / (e.total_waits - nvl(b.total_waits,0))), 2) avgwt,
((round ((e.time_waited_micro - nvl(b.time_waited_micro,0))/1000000, 2)) / ((s5t1.value - s5t0.value) / 1000000))*100 as pctdbt, -- THIS IS EVENT (sec) / DB TIME (sec)
(round ((e.time_waited_micro - nvl(b.time_waited_micro,0))/1000000, 2))/60 / round(EXTRACT(DAY F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 1440
+ EXTRACT(HOUR F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 60
+ EXTRACT(MINUTE F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ME)
+ EXTRACT(SECOND F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) / 60, 2) aas, -- THIS IS EVENT (min) / SnapDur (min) TO GET THE % DB CPU ON AAS
e.wait_class wait_class
from
dba_hist_snapshot s0,
dba_hist_snapshot s1,
dba_hist_system_event b,
dba_hist_system_event e,
dba_hist_sys_time_model s5t0,
dba_hist_sys_time_model s5t1
where
s0.dbid = &_dbid -- CHANGE THE DBID HERE!
AND s1.dbid = s0.dbid
and b.dbid(+) = s0.dbid
and e.dbid = s0.dbid
AND s5t0.dbid = s0.dbid
AND s5t1.dbid = s0.dbid
AND s0.instance_number = &_instancenumber -- CHANGE THE INSTANCE_NUMBER HERE!
AND s1.instance_number = s0.instance_number
and b.instance_number(+) = s0.instance_number
and e.instance_number = s0.instance_number
AND s5t0.instance_number = s0.instance_number
AND s5t1.instance_number = s0.instance_number
AND s1.snap_id = s0.snap_id + 1
AND b.snap_id(+) = s0.snap_id
and e.snap_id = s0.snap_id + 1
AND s5t0.snap_id = s0.snap_id
AND s5t1.snap_id = s0.snap_id + 1
and s0.startup_time = s1.startup_time
AND s5t0.stat_name = 'DB time'
AND s5t1.stat_name = s5t0.stat_name
and b.event_id = e.event_id
and e.wait_class != 'Idle'
and e.total_waits > nvl(b.total_waits,0)
and e.event_name not in ('smon timer',
'pmon timer',
'dispatcher timer',
'dispatcher listen timer',
'rdbms ipc message')
order by snap_id, time desc, waits desc, event)
union all
select
s0.snap_id snap_id,
s0.END_INTERVAL_TIME tm,
s0.instance_number inst,
round(EXTRACT(DAY F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 1440
+ EXTRACT(HOUR F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 60
+ EXTRACT(MINUTE F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ME)
+ EXTRACT(SECOND F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) / 60, 2) dur,
'CPU time',
0,
round ((s6t1.value - s6t0.value) / 1000000, 2) as time, -- THIS IS DB CPU (sec)
0,
((round ((s6t1.value - s6t0.value) / 1000000, 2)) / ((s5t1.value - s5t0.value) / 1000000))*100 as pctdbt, -- THIS IS DB CPU (sec) / DB TIME (sec)..TO GET % OF DB CPU ON DB TIME FOR TOP 5 TIMED EVENTS SECTION
(round ((s6t1.value - s6t0.value) / 1000000, 2))/60 / round(EXTRACT(DAY F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 1440
+ EXTRACT(HOUR F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) * 60
+ EXTRACT(MINUTE F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ME)
+ EXTRACT(SECOND FROM s1.END_INTERVAL_TIME - s0.END_INTERVAL_TIME) / 60, 2) aas, -- THIS IS DB CPU (min) / SnapDur (min) TO GET THE % DB CPU ON AAS
'CPU'
from
dba_hist_snapshot s0,
dba_hist_snapshot s1,
dba_hist_sys_time_model s6t0,
dba_hist_sys_time_model s6t1,
dba_hist_sys_time_model s5t0,
dba_hist_sys_time_model s5t1
WHERE
s0.dbid = &_dbid -- CHANGE THE DBID HERE!
AND s1.dbid = s0.dbid
AND s6t0.dbid = s0.dbid
AND s6t1.dbid = s0.dbid
AND s5t0.dbid = s0.dbid
AND s5t1.dbid = s0.dbid
AND s0.instance_number = &_instancenumber -- CHANGE THE INSTANCE_NUMBER HERE!
AND s1.instance_number = s0.instance_number
AND s6t0.instance_number = s0.instance_number
AND s6t1.instance_number = s0.instance_number
AND s5t0.instance_number = s0.instance_number
AND s5t1.instance_number = s0.instance_number
AND s1.snap_id = s0.snap_id + 1
AND s6t0.snap_id = s0.snap_id
AND s6t1.snap_id = s0.snap_id + 1
AND s5t0.snap_id = s0.snap_id
AND s5t1.snap_id = s0.snap_id + 1
and s0.startup_time = s1.startup_time
AND s6t0.stat_name = 'DB CPU'
AND s6t1.stat_name = s6t0.stat_name
AND s5t0.stat_name = 'DB time'
AND s5t1.stat_name = s5t0.stat_name
)
)
)
where
-- event_rank <= 5 and
to_char(tm,'d') >= &&DayOfWeek1 -- day of week: 1=sunday 7=saturday
and to_char(tm,'d') <= &&DayOfWeek2
and to_char(tm,'hh24mi') >= &&Hour1 -- hour
and to_char(tm,'hh24mi') <= &&Hour2
and tm >= to_date('&&DataRange1','yyyy-mon-dd hh24:mi:ss') -- data range
and tm <= to_date('&&DataRange2','yyyy-mon-dd hh24:mi:ss')
;
